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1462 088 510965663
63246268 650916
63246268 650916
592471863 04 31499914511
All about undefined
Interested in learning more?
63246268 650916
592471863 04 31499914511
See more
39 365473
8017387068 28823 91675745
See more
9676728 712231250
127536 9796832363 909 89
See more